Transaction 8375279f3d99ae8a7babddae81a9246ce2ac84d7253bdcfc37c098aa6331d894
1 Input
1 Output
-
8375279f3d99ae8a7babddae81a9246ce2ac84d7253bdcfc37c098aa6331d894:0
- value
- 17594838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a7e01b5c0af7f47753c7fa0ca7f7d93f8c2499e OP_EQUAL
- address
- 3FmtwBaca7MFk2S7N3n5oBkQmxHsEMgXQ1